For more * information on the Apache Software Foundation, please see * <http://www.apache.org/>. * * [Additional notices, if required by prior licensing conditions] * */ package org.apache.tomcat.util.net.jsse;import org.apache.tomcat.util.net.SSLSupport;import java.io.*;import java.net.*;import java.util.Vector;import java.security.cert.CertificateFactory;import javax.net.ssl.SSLSession;import javax.net.ssl.SSLSocket;import javax.net.ssl.HandshakeCompletedListener;import javax.net.ssl.HandshakeCompletedEvent;import java.security.cert.CertificateFactory;import javax.security.cert.X509Certificate;/* JSSESupport   Concrete implementation class for JSSE   Support classes.   This will only work with JDK 1.2 and up since it   depends on JDK 1.2's certificate support   @author EKR   @author Craig R. McClanahan   Parts cribbed from JSSECertCompat          Parts cribbed from CertificatesValve*/class JSSESupport implements SSLSupport {    private SSLSocket ssl;    JSSESupport(SSLSocket sock){        ssl=sock;    }    public String getCipherSuite() throws IOException {        // Look up the current SSLSession        SSLSession session = ssl.getSession();        if (session == null)            return null;        return session.getCipherSuite();    }    public Object[] getPeerCertificateChain() 	throws IOException {	return getPeerCertificateChain(false);    }    public Object[] getPeerCertificateChain(boolean force)	throws IOException {        // Look up the current SSLSession        SSLSession session = ssl.getSession();        if (session == null)            return null;        // Convert JSSE's certificate format to the ones we need        X509Certificate jsseCerts[] = null;        java.security.cert.X509Certificate x509Certs[] = null;        try {	    try {		jsseCerts = session.getPeerCertificateChain();	    } catch(Exception bex) {		// ignore.	    }            if (jsseCerts == null)                jsseCerts = new X509Certificate[0];	    if(jsseCerts.length <= 0 && force) {		session.invalidate();		ssl.setNeedClientAuth(true);		ssl.startHandshake();		if ("1.4".equals(System.getProperty("java.specification.version"))) {		    synchronousHandshake(ssl);		}		session = ssl.getSession();		jsseCerts = session.getPeerCertificateChain();		if(jsseCerts == null)		    jsseCerts = new X509Certificate[0];	    }            x509Certs =              new java.security.cert.X509Certificate[jsseCerts.length];            for (int i = 0; i < x509Certs.length; i++) {                byte buffer[] = jsseCerts[i].getEncoded();                CertificateFactory cf =                  CertificateFactory.getInstance("X.509");                ByteArrayInputStream stream =                  new ByteArrayInputStream(buffer);                x509Certs[i] = (java.security.cert.X509Certificate)                  cf.generateCertificate(stream);            }	} catch (Throwable t) {	    return null;        }        if ((x509Certs == null) || (x509Certs.length < 1))            return null;        return x509Certs;    }    /**     * Copied from <code>org.apache.catalina.valves.CertificateValve</code>     */    public Integer getKeySize()         throws IOException {        // Look up the current SSLSession        SSLSession session = ssl.getSession();        SSLSupport.CipherData c_aux[]=ciphers;        if (session == null)            return null;        Integer keySize = (Integer) session.getValue(KEY_SIZE_KEY);        if (keySize == null) {            int size = 0;            String cipherSuite = session.getCipherSuite();            for (int i = 0; i < c_aux.length; i++) {                if (cipherSuite.indexOf(c_aux[i].phrase) >= 0) {                    size = c_aux[i].keySize;                    break;                }            }            keySize = new Integer(size);            session.putValue(KEY_SIZE_KEY, keySize);        }        return keySize;    }    public String getSessionId()        throws IOException {        // Look up the current SSLSession        SSLSession session = ssl.getSession();        if (session == null)            return null;        // Expose ssl_session (getId)        byte [] ssl_session = session.getId();        if ( ssl_session == null)             return null;        StringBuffer buf=new StringBuffer("");        for(int x=0; x<ssl_session.length; x++) {            String digit=Integer.toHexString((int)ssl_session[x]);            if (digit.length()<2) buf.append('0');            if (digit.length()>2) digit=digit.substring(digit.length()-2);            buf.append(digit);        }        return buf.toString();    }    /**     * JSSE in JDK 1.4 has an issue/feature that requires us to do a     * read() to get the client-cert.  As suggested by Andreas     * Sterbenz     */    private static void synchronousHandshake(SSLSocket socket)         throws IOException {        InputStream in = socket.getInputStream();        int oldTimeout = socket.getSoTimeout();        socket.setSoTimeout(100);        Listener listener = new Listener();        socket.addHandshakeCompletedListener(listener);        byte[] b = new byte[0];        socket.startHandshake();        int maxTries = 50; // 50 * 100 = example 5 second rehandshake timeout        for (int i = 0; i < maxTries; i++) {            try {                int x = in.read(b);            } catch (IOException e) {                // ignore - presumably the timeout            }            if (listener.completed) {                break;            }        }        socket.removeHandshakeCompletedListener(listener);        socket.setSoTimeout(oldTimeout);        if (listener.completed == false) {            throw new SocketException("SSL Cert handshake timeout");        }    }    private static class Listener implements HandshakeCompletedListener {        volatile boolean completed = false;        public void handshakeCompleted(HandshakeCompletedEvent event) {            completed = true;        }    }}
